Real estate transactions are complicated and unpredictable. Professional real estate agents are trained to handle the many facets of buying a home. A good agent is an invaluable asset to your venture if you are in the market for a house.
When you find a real estate agent with whom you feel confident, it is good to enter into a committed working relationship with that person. Concentrating your search with one agent will allow that agent to become truly familiar with your needs, desires, and financial capacities.
Maintaining loyalty to the real estate agent of your choice will bear you more fruit than scattering your attention among several agents. An agent who feels your commitment will devote his or her entire energy to finding the right home for you.

What famous Art Deco skyscraper is decorated with eagle hood ornaments, hubcaps and abstract images of cars?
|
| A |
New York's Chrysler Building, designed by architect William Van Alen in 1930, was one of the first buildings composed of stainless steel over a large surface area.
